How much do internship r statistics j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 26, 2026, the average hourly pay for internship r statistics in Plano, TX is $16.56,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.80 and $18.41 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an R Statistics Intern, and why are they important?

To thrive as an R Statistics Intern, a solid understanding of statistical concepts, data analysis, and proficiency in R programming—often supported by coursework in statistics or data science—is essential. Familiarity with data visualization tools, R packages like dplyr and ggplot2, and version control systems such as Git is typically expected. Strong analytical thinking, attention to detail, and effective communication skills help interns interpret results and collaborate with team members. These skills ensure accurate data-driven insights and smooth integration into research or analytics projects.

What types of projects or tasks can I expect to work on during an R Statistics internship?

As an R Statistics intern, you can expect to work on a variety of data-driven projects such as cleaning and analyzing large datasets, creating statistical models, and generating visualizations using R. You may collaborate closely with data scientists and other team members to support ongoing research, prepare reports, or assist in automating data workflows. Interns often have the opportunity to present their findings to the team and contribute to real-world decision-making processes, making this role a valuable learning experience for future careers in data analysis or statistics.

What are Internship R Statistics positions?

Internship R Statistics positions are internships that focus on using the R programming language for statistical analysis and data processing. These roles are typically aimed at students or recent graduates who want hands-on experience working with data, performing statistical modeling, and visualizing results using R. Interns may work in various industries, such as healthcare, finance, or technology, and often assist with tasks like data cleaning, exploratory data analysis, and report generation. These internships help participants develop practical skills in R, deepen their understanding of statistics, and prepare them for careers in data science or analytics.

Job Description

VWH is seeking to hire a Quantitative Research Intern to work with the firm's analytics and investment team. This role will work closely with key stakeholders and contribute to the continued growth and success of VWH's residential mortgage and securities business as well as new opportunities and strategies. Ultimately, a successful candidate will be considered for full-time employment upon completion of their internship and degree.

Responsibilities
Conduct empirical analysis on residential mortgage performance including prepayment, default, loss severity and transition matrix based on large scale of loan level data
Develop a full spectrum of statistical models including prepayment, default, loss severity and multi-step transition models to analyze loan performance
Conduct full-scale backtests including in-sample and out-of-sample tests for models developed
Coordinate with the analytics team to implement statistical models and apply to investment decision making
Assist in exploring models for new investment products
Communicate to senior management on model attributes, performance, forecasts and risk/valuation implications
Other duties as assigned.

Qualifications

Holding or working toward a PhD in Statistics, Economics, Finance or other related quantitative fields
Proficiency in statistical and econometric modeling, such as survival analysis, time series models, logistic regression, multinomial logistic regression, Monte Carlo simulation, as well as machine learning
Hands on experience in working with large scale data sets
Familiarity with financial mathematics, knowledge of mortgage analytics is a plus
Proficiency in R/Python/Java or other statistical software packages.
Ability to manage multiple tasks and deliver high quality work in a dynamic environment
Ability to work in Uptown Dallas office
US work authorization is required. The firm will sponsor H1B for full-time employees.
